INDIAN OCEAN (Jan. 20, 2022) Lt. Minghe Zang, left, a dental officer assigned to amphibious transport dock USS Portland (LPD 27), and Hospital Corpsman 3rd Class Tristan Rowley, assigned to Alpha Company Battalion Landing Team 1/1, 11th Marine Expeditionary Unit (MEU), triage a simulated casualty during a mass casualty training event aboard Portland. 11th MEU and Essex Amphibious Ready Group are operating in U.S. 7th Fleet to enhance interoperability with alliances and partners and serve as a ready response force to ensure maritime security and a free and open Indo-Pacific region.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Patrick Katz)
